Real Madrid is facing a significant midfield decision ahead of their Champions League clash against Bayern Munich. Manager Alvaro Arbeloa is considering starting 18-year-old Thiago Pitarch over 23-year-old Eduardo Camavinga due to Camavinga's underwhelming performance in a recent 1-1 draw against Girona. With Aurelien Tchouameni suspended, the expectation was for Camavinga to take the holding midfield role. However, his struggles in that position have prompted the coaching staff to explore alternatives. Pitarch, who has delivered consistent performances this season, could be given a chance to shine on a major stage. The midfield is expected to include Jude Bellingham, Federico Valverde, and Arda Guler, forming a strong core as the team aims for a place in the semi-finals of the tournament.
